I had given up on Ford and told myself I would NEVER buy another one due to horrible customer service after purchase. Recently my paint cracked on the rear-right quarter panel. Although very small, still noticeable to me. I took a long shot and drove to Kieffe and Sons Ford in Mojave, CA on the advice of a friend. They looked at it and without complaint took it in for panel replacement and painting. WHAT!! No arguing, no fighting, no threats. Just simple, good customer service. Got the truck back a week later and guess what, Awesome job and they debadged it for the painting. (I was thinking of doing it for the longest)Now I get to see if I like the badges off or I can take it back and let them put them back on. They restored my faith in American dealerships and customer service. Did I mention I didn't buy the truck from them. Great people, just had to tell someone.:D
